GRAYSLAKE, Ill. – State Rep. Sam Yingling, D-Grayslake, is reminding local residents, teachers and other academic professionals about his upcoming Education Citizen Advisory Committee Meeting that will take place on Tuesday, March 22 at 10 a.m. at the Grayslake Public Library’s community meeting room.


"This event is an opportunity to show up and be a part of the conversation about the state's education policy and how it affects our schools," Yingling said. "Educational outcomes for our children are so much better when parents and educators are working together. I am glad to help foster the cooperation that we know is active in our community. "
